After rumors surfaced last week, author Brian Lee O’Malley has confirmed that Arrested Development/Superbad/Juno alum Michael Cera will be playing the title character in the upcoming movie adaptation of his comic series Scott Pilgrim. It’s being directed by Edgar Wright, best known for writing and directing Shaun Of The Dead.
If you’re not familiar with Scott Pilgrim, now’s the time to catch up. The multi-book series follows 23-year-old Canadian Pilgrim, who meets his dream woman, a American delivery girl named Ramona. But in order to wife her, he must first defeat her seven “evil” ex boyfriends, who all have special powers. It has plenty of rock ‘n’ roll and fighting, if you’re into that sort of thing.
